Kochi
KOCHI, SEPT. 9. The agitation organised by the Campion School unit of the All Kerala CBSE Schools Parents' Association was called off following a consensus reached at a meeting convened by the District Collector here today. The Association had been demanding reduction of fees and formation of the Parent-Teachers Association at the school. The meeting decided to form the welfare committee to address the grievances of the parents. . The management also agreed to withdraw the hike in fees.
